Challenges and Downsides
Like any job, being a bar host comes with its downsides. The work can be physically demanding, requiring lengthy hours of standing and constant movement. Peak occasions could be annoying, with crowded lobbies and impatient clients. The balancing act between preserving the customers pleased and executing operational duties can typically feel overwhelm

Understanding the Role of a Bar Host
First, let’s make clear what a bar host does. A bar host is the face of the bar, the primary particular person customers see after they walk in. Their duties vary from greeting visitors, managing reservations, seating patrons, and guaranteeing the general guest expertise is top-notch. They also coordinate with the rest of the employees to maintain every thing running smoothly. The position requires a mix of hospitality, multitasking, and a eager eye for elem



Host bars are unique institutions where hosts, typically charming and enticing individuals, entertain and socialize with patrons. Unlike conventional bars, the level of interest right here is the interpersonal connection rather than simply promoting drinks. In many elements of the world, particularly in East Asia, host bars have gained significant recognition and cultural releva
